Adelaide had a difficult task last week. Not only did they go up against a side that already had a game under their belt, they played in wet conditions which greatly advantaged their opponents, the Suns.
Despite that, the Crows made a big charge in the fourth quarter to just miss and go under by a goal.
There were plenty of positives for the Crows to take out of the loss. They won the inside 50 and contested possession count. They broken even with the much vaunted Suns midfield in clearances.
The Crows should welcome back Taylor Walker for this one and he was arguably the outstanding key forward in the league last season.
This is a much tougher challenge for Geelong than playing the Saints at home. Geelong are very good at stopping opposition from moving the ball from end to end at their very narrow home ground and that was why they were able to win the game.
Historically the Cats form at the Adelaide Oval against the Crows is poor. They have only won three from seven and only covered in two of them. Adelaide was a force to be reckoned with last year at the Adelaide Oval, winning nine of thirteen games and covering in ten.
